1st homegrown cruise ship starts trial operation
    2023-12-25  08:53    Shenzhen Daily

CHINA’S first domestically-built large cruise ship, Adora Magic City, departed from a port in Shanghai yesterday, starting its trial operation.

Carrying invited guests and nearly 1,300 crew members from around the world, the ship set off after noontime yesterday from the Shanghai Wusongkou International Cruise Terminal and is expected to return to the terminal today.

Another trial operation is scheduled afterward to prepare for the commercial maiden voyage to Northeast Asia on Jan. 1, 2024.

The voyage will last seven days en route to Jeju in South Korea and Nagasaki and Fukuoka in Japan. A route between China and Southeast Asia will be launched at a later date.

It will also launch a route following the Maritime Silk Road, providing diversified vacation options to passengers.

Measuring 323.6 meters in length with a gross tonnage of 135,500, Adora Magic City can accommodate up to 5,246 passengers.

It has 16 floors and a total of 40,000 square meters of public living and recreation space.

This one-of-a-kind cruise ship is tailor-made for the Chinese market, boasting a wide range of innovative features and amenities with authentic Chinese and international gourmet food, entertaining shows, and shopping experiences at sea with a fusion of East and West.

“It is a brand new ship and we have made a lot of preparations,” said Captain Niklas Peterstam. “We have more than 1,200 crew members and it is a big task.

“The equipment is tested to maximum. Everyone is waiting for the moment.”

Partnering with China Duty Free Group to offer the largest duty-free retail space at sea, the ship features a trendy and state-of-the-art shopping center, covering an area of approximately 2,000 square meters.

The ship also features an array of thrilling facilities for children and teens, including a water park with three slides across four decks, a 360-degree sea view rope garden, and a realistic and immersive VR game center.
